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Cauliflower vs Garden Cress:
- 1 pound of Cauliflower has 2.8 times more Vitamin B5 than Garden Cress.
- While 1 lb of Raw Garden Cress contains more Vitamin A, 1.6 times more Vitamin B1, 4.3 times more Vitamin B2, 2 times more Vitamin B3, 1.3 times more Vitamin B6, 1.4 times more Vitamin B9, 1.4 times more Vitamin C, 8.8 times more Vitamin E and 35 times more Vitamin K than Raw Cauliflower.
- 1 pound of Cauliflower have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in E
- Both Raw Cauliflower as well as Raw Garden Cress have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one pound.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Cauliflower vs Garden Cress:
- 1 pound of Cauliflower has 2.1 times more Sodium than Garden Cress.
- While 1 lb of Raw Garden Cress contains 3.7 times more Calcium, 4.4 times more Copper, 3.1 times more Iron, 2.5 times more Magnesium, 3.6 times more Manganese, 1.7 times more Phosphorus and 2 times more Potassium than Raw Cauliflower.
- Both Cauliflower and Garden Cress contain similar levels of Zinc and Water per one pound.
- Both Raw Cauliflower as well as Raw Garden Cress l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in one pound.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
- 1 pound of Cauliflower has 1.8 times more Fiber than Garden Cress.
- While 1 lb of Raw Garden Cress contains 5.1 times more Omega 3, 2.3 times more Sugars and 1.4 times more Protein than Raw Cauliflower.
- Both Cauliflower and Garden Cress offer comparable quantities of Carbohydrate per one pound.
- 1 pound of Cauliflower prov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3
- Both Raw Cauliflower as well as Raw Garden Cress provide inadequate amounts of Energy and Omega 6 in one pound.
